Redundant power techniques for servers explained

Posted: 08 May 2007  Print Version  Bookmark and Share Subscribe

Keywords: redundant power  high availability systems  field effect transistor  ORing controller 

[Summary of tips] Redundant power is a critical component in high availability systems. In the simplest solution, two power supplies can drive a load through diodes to OR their outputs together.
